Question

What type of user (persona) has clearly defined paths and workflows in the platform and have one or more roles (ie itil and approver_user)?

Options

  • AWorkflow User
  • BRequest Fulfiller
  • CITSM User
  • DApproving Manager
  • EService Desk User
  • FProcess User

Explanation

The question asks to identify a user persona with defined workflows and roles like itil and approver_user.

Common mistakes.

  • A. "Workflow User" is not a standard, well-defined persona in ServiceNow that specifically encompasses the described roles and responsibilities.
  • B. While a Request Fulfiller works within workflows, the description emphasizes roles like approver_user and managerial approval paths, which are distinct from general fulfillment.
  • C. "ITSM User" is too broad and does not specifically define the persona with clear approval paths and roles like approver_user.
  • E. A Service Desk User primarily handles incident and request fulfillment, not typically characterized by the "approver_user" role and specific managerial approval workflows.
  • F. "Process User" is a generic term and not a specific persona within ServiceNow that precisely matches the described characteristics of an approver.
